About
ALE LLC provides portfolio management, financial planning and pension consulting to individuals (including high‑net‑worth clients), pension and profit‑sharing plans, pooled investment vehicles, and business entities. The firm offers comprehensive portfolio management (including a wrap‑fee option), written financial plans or consultations, and one‑time or ongoing pension consulting engagements.
Accounts are managed primarily on a non‑discretionary basis, with client approval required before transactions and at least quarterly account reviews as part of an individualized advisory process. The firm employs a broad set of analytical methods—fundamental, technical, quantitative and qualitative—and uses strategies across fixed income and equities, including long‑ and short‑term positions, options, margin and active trading when appropriate.
Distinctive aspects include the principal’s active licensure and business activity in real estate brokerage and insurance distribution, the firm’s role as a wrap‑fee program sponsor, and its provision of pension consulting—each of which is relatively uncommon among independent advisers. The firm manages roughly $9 million in non‑discretionary assets for a small client base and discloses and seeks to mitigate conflicts of interest arising from commissionable real estate and insurance activities through disclosures and its Code of Ethics.

Fee options
Financial planning and consulting flat fees range from $1,000 to $10,000. Pension consulting flat fees range from $1,000 to $10,000 annually
$0 - $1,999,999: 1.00% annually (Equity & Balanced Portfolios) $2,000,000 - $4,999,999: 0.85% annually (Equity & Balanced Portfolios) $5,000,000 - $9,999,999: 0.75% annually (Equity & Balanced Portfolios) $10,000,000+: 0.65% annually (Equity & Balanced Portfolios) $0 - $1,999,999: 0.50% annually (Fixed Income Portfolios) $2,000,000 - $4,999,999: 0.43% annually (Fixed Income Portfolios) $5,000,000 - $9,999,999: 0.38% annually (Fixed Income Portfolios) $10,000,000+: 0.33% annually (Fixed Income Portfolios)
Financial planning up to $350/hour; pension consulting up to $250/hour
Account minimum: $250,000 Fee-only: Financial planning and consulting fees: $1,000 to $10,000 flat fee; hourly fees up to $350/hour. Pension consulting fees: $1,000 to $10,000 flat fee annually, hourly fees up to $250/hour, or up to 1.00% of plan assets
